Title: Some niobium(V) complexes and their relevance to the uptake of niobium by ascidians
Abstract: Ascidians have been reported to absorb many unusual elements, including niobium. A study of some aqueous niobium(V) chemistry is used to identify potential ligating systems. It is proposed from the inorganic chemical evidence that these marine organisms may concentrate other early second and third row transition elements.
